Understanding the Bible Presbyterian Church
Before we zero in on the Iesperana branch, let's get a handle on what it means to be a Bible Presbyterian Church. At its heart, this tradition emphasizes the authority and sufficiency of the Bible. Think of it as a commitment to a literal interpretation of scripture and a belief that the Bible is the ultimate guide for faith and life. This often means a strong focus on sound doctrine, evangelism, and missions. They tend to hold to the historic creeds and confessions of the Protestant Reformation, which are foundational documents that articulate core Christian beliefs. Core Beliefs and Practices
Let's dive into the core beliefs and practices that you'll likely encounter within an Iesperana Bible Presbyterian Church. As mentioned, the Bible is the supreme authority. This means they hold to the inerrancy and infallibility of Scripture – the belief that the Bible, in its original writings, is without error and is the final word on all matters of faith and practice. Theology is typically Calvinistic or Reformed. This includes doctrines like the sovereignty of God, election, the atonement of Christ, irresistible grace, and perseverance of the saints (often summarized as TULIP). You'll find a strong emphasis on the glory of God as the ultimate purpose of all things. The Gospel is central. They believe in salvation by grace alone, through faith alone, in Christ alone. This means a deep commitment to evangelism and sharing the good news of Jesus Christ. Worship is usually God-centered and reverent. Expect a focus on preaching, teaching, congregational singing of hymns that are theologically rich, and prayer. While styles can vary, the emphasis is on glorifying God and building up the church through the Word. Sacraments, namely Baptism and the Lord's Supper, are observed according to their understanding of biblical teaching, often with a focus on their spiritual significance and the covenantal nature of God's relationship with His people. Church Governance is Presbyterian, meaning churches are governed by elders (presbyters) in parity, with congregations typically represented at regional and national levels (presbyteries and synods/general assemblies). Missions and Evangelism are not just activities but fundamental aspects of the church's identity. They are driven by the Great Commission to make disciples of all nations.
